Output efed53ec3690a51ec097ede5932af504f5e59d5d309fcafb5a4d6b4955ba637b:0

value
24655991
script pubkey
OP_0 OP_PUSHBYTES_20 a176efdf92ec43c74ec1a24eba8479424168634c
address
ltc1q59mwlhuja3puwnkp5f8t4pregfqksc6v2cz704
transaction
efed53ec3690a51ec097ede5932af504f5e59d5d309fcafb5a4d6b4955ba637b
spent
true